@@ -568,13 +568,13 @@ class concat_view<_Views...>::__iterator {
568568 __it_x.template __apply_at_index <tuple_size_v<decltype (__x.__parent_ ->__views_ )>>(
569569 __ix, [&](auto __index_constant_x) {
570570 constexpr size_t __index_x = __index_constant_x.value ;
571- auto __dx = ranges::__distance (ranges::begin (std::get<__index_x>(__x.__parent_ ->__views_ )), __it_x);
571+ auto __dx = ranges::distance (ranges::begin (std::get<__index_x>(__x.__parent_ ->__views_ )), __it_x);
572572
573573 __it_y.template __apply_at_index <tuple_size_v<decltype (__y.__parent_ ->__views_ )>>(
574574 __iy, [&](auto __index_constant_y) {
575575 constexpr size_t __index_y = __index_constant_y.value ;
576576 auto __dy =
577- ranges::__distance (ranges::begin (std::get<__index_y>(__y.__parent_ ->__views_ )), __it_y);
577+ ranges::distance (ranges::begin (std::get<__index_y>(__y.__parent_ ->__views_ )), __it_y);
578578 difference_type __s = 0 ;
579579 for (size_t __idx = __index_y + 1 ; __idx < __index_x; __idx++) {
580580 __s += ranges::size (std::get<__idx>(__x.__parent_ ->__views_ ));
@@ -615,7 +615,7 @@ class concat_view<_Views...>::__iterator {
615615 __it_x.template __apply_at_index <tuple_size_v<decltype (__x.__parent_ ->__views_ )>>(
616616 __ix, [&](auto __index_constant) {
617617 constexpr size_t __index_x = __index_constant.value ;
618- auto __dx = ranges::__distance (ranges::begin (std::get<__index_x>(__x.__parent_ ->__views_ )), __it_x);
618+ auto __dx = ranges::distance (ranges::begin (std::get<__index_x>(__x.__parent_ ->__views_ )), __it_x);
619619
620620 difference_type __s = 0 ;
621621 for (size_t __idx = 0 ; __idx < __index_x; __idx++) {
0 commit comments